### 3.1.0 — Renamed `POOL_AUTH` to `LEDGERPINE_POOL_CREDENTIAL`

The old name collided with a variable used by the retired Ashgate proxy. Pool sizing defaults are unchanged (min 4, max 32). Update any deployment scripts you inherit; the connection broker refuses to start if both names are set. Add this line to the service's environment file:

secret setting of bajeg-yahog: LEDGER_TOKEN20=f833f3e2e6625ec0dee3

### Checklist: Greenhouse sensor drift check

Before shipping the Vinecroft controller update, eyeball the humidity sensors — a few units drift high after firmware flashes, and support gets the calls when tomatoes get overwatered. Run the recalibration sweep, make sure readings settle within tolerance, and flag any stubborn units. The token for the calibrated build sits right below.

pipeline stamp: htk3_cc5

**Ticket SNAP-0 (severity: medium)**

The Pixforge CLI for batch image resizing follows symlinks inside the input directory without validation. A crafted link pointing outside the working tree lets resized output land in arbitrary writable paths. Noticed during the Bramhall audit; reproducible on the 2.4 line with default flags. Security reviewer should confirm whether the sandbox profile on the Wrenfield runners mitigates this. No evidence of exploitation in logs so far. The affected build token is recorded below.

session token of tajog-fahaf = htk21_4ae55819f45410afcb307

Subject: Handover — session-token refresh fix (Larkspur 3.2.1)

Hi all,

Handing release duties to Mirelle. Plugin authors: the session-token refresh bug that dropped tokens mid-renewal is fixed in 3.2.1. Update your plugins to retry on the new 419 response rather than forcing re-auth. Compatibility notes are in the Larkspur dev portal. Verify downloaded SDK builds against the release signing key below.

rollout seal: bky4_x7Gc